Output 058a6babf4a39799551cd423774d6468e4acabdb170256396d7eab1384a1b3b6:3

value
21085000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a9bb648b9e439caa91227f6d3d7d045416a40e OP_EQUAL
address
3KSJLwmoQjNsxArbDQ2HetuFZVGq8uMXQp
transaction
058a6babf4a39799551cd423774d6468e4acabdb170256396d7eab1384a1b3b6
spent
true